Is Microsoft Defender and Windows security the same

Windows Security is a complete security suite with Microsoft Defender antivirus and other security features. In earlier versions of Windows 10, Windows Security was called Windows Defender Security Center. To see all the security areas of Windows Security, open Windows Security through Windows Search.

Did Windows Defender change to Windows security

In Windows 10, version 1703 and later, the Windows Defender app is part of the Windows Security. Settings that were previously part of the Windows Defender client and main Windows Settings have been combined and moved to the new app, which is installed by default as part of Windows 10, version 1703.

Why has Windows Defender been turned off

Check for Malware

Malware can turn off Defender and keep it off despite your best efforts to re-enable it. If you aren't able to turn Defender back on you might be infected. Install and run another malware detector of your choice and see if you can find and remove the infection.

How do I know if my window Defender is on

Use the Windows Security app to check the status of Microsoft Defender Antivirus. On your Windows device, select the Start menu, and begin typing Security . Then open the Windows Security app in the results. Select Virus & threat protection.

What is Windows Defender called now

As of 2023, Microsoft Defender Antivirus is part of the much larger Microsoft Defender brand, which includes several other software and service offerings, including: Microsoft 365 Defender. Microsoft Defender for Cloud. Microsoft Defender Endpoint.
